SSC results to be published Thursday

The results of this year’s Secondary School Certificate (SSC) and equivalent examinations will be published at 2:00 PM on Thursday across Bangladesh.

The Inter-Education Board Coordination Committee confirmed the schedule in two separate notices signed by its chairman, Professor Khondokar Ehsanul Kabir.

This year, 19,28,181 students took part in the SSC and equivalent exams held between April 10 and May 22.

The results will be available through the official websites of 11 education boards, via SMS and at respective educational institutions and exam centres.

The results will be released by Boards of Intermediate and Secondary Education in Dhaka, Rajshahi, Cumilla, Jashore, Chattogram, Barishal, Sylhet, Dinajpur and Mymensingh, along with Bangladesh Madrasah Education Board and Bangladesh Technical Education Board.

A views-exchange meeting with journalists will also be held on the occasion at conference room of Dhaka Education Board.

Students can access their results online by visiting www.educationboardresults.gov.bd and entering their roll and registration numbers.

Institutional result sheets can be downloaded from the respective board websites by using the institution’s EIIN number. For example, institutions under the Dhaka board can retrieve result sheets through www.dhakaeducationboard.gov.bd by clicking the “result corner.”

Additionally, examinees can receive their results via SMS by sending a message to 16222. To do this, students must type the exam name (SSC, Dakhil or SSC Tec for technical board), the first three letters of the education board’s name, the roll number and the exam year. For example: SSC DHA 123456 2025.

For those wishing to apply for re-evaluation, the application window will remain open from July 11 to 17. Applications must be submitted via SMS. To apply, candidates need to send a message to 16222 with the format RSC followed by the board code, roll number and subject code(s). A fee of Tk 150 will be charged per subject.

Teletalk Bangladesh Ltd., state-run mobile operator, is managing the SMS service for result distribution and re-evaluation applications.
